#714fea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#714fea is composed of 44.3% red, 31%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.7%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 253.2 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 61.4%. #714fea color hex could be obtained by blending #e29eff with #0000d5.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#714fea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#714fea has RGB values of R:113, G:79, B:234 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 7426026.

Shades and Tints of #714fea

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050211 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#714fea

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9b9e is the less saturated color, while #6840f9 is the most saturated one.
